Comprehensive Service Overview

Roofing work in Terlingua typically revolves around a few core needs: durability against sun exposure, wind resistance, and proper installation given the remote setting.

For residential properties, repair and replacement projects often involve materials that can handle the desert climate. Metal roofing is a common choice here because of its reflectivity and longevity under UV exposure. Asphalt shingles are also used, though they tend to have a shorter lifespan in this environment and require quality underlayment to perform well. Tile roofing shows up on some of the area's more distinctive homes, adding thermal mass that helps with temperature regulation.

A thorough inspection is often the starting point—especially after a wind event or if you've noticed signs of interior wear. Good inspections focus on finding the exact source of any problem, whether it's a lifted flashing, a compromised seal around a chimney or vent, or a section of roofing that's simply reached the end of its service life. The goal is to pinpoint the source fast with targeted repairs that stop water intrusion and prevent further damage.

For commercial properties in and around Terlingua, roofing considerations lean toward flat or low-slope systems on retail spaces, workshops, and hospitality buildings. Modified bitumen, PVC, and TPO membranes are common, and the same UV and temperature concerns apply. Proper flashing details and regular maintenance make a meaningful difference in how long these systems last.

Why Choose a Local Pro?

Roofing in Brewster County is shaped by conditions that aren't always obvious from outside the region. The thermal cycling—going from scorching days to cool nights—puts constant stress on materials. The wind patterns here are distinct. And the remote location means that supply chains and response times operate differently than in a metro area.

Someone familiar with the area understands which materials hold up best in this specific environment, how to account for the area's unique housing stock, and what to expect when working on properties spread across rugged terrain. Building codes and permit requirements can vary depending on whether you're in the county, within a subdivision like Terlingua Ranch, or near the national park boundary. A locally grounded approach respects those differences without assuming one-size-fits-all.

Regional Characteristics

Terlingua sits in the high desert of far West Texas, where temperatures regularly climb above 100°F in summer and overnight lows can dip below freezing in winter. The housing stock is unusually diverse—historic adobe and stone structures from the mining era sit alongside modern off-grid homes, manufactured homes, and custom desert builds. Many properties are spread across rugged terrain with limited road access, and the area's remote nature means local materials and labor availability look very different than they would in a major city.

Common Issues

UV damage and thermal expansion are the most consistent concerns here. The intense sun accelerates wear on roofing materials, particularly asphalt shingles and exposed fasteners. Wind uplift during seasonal storms can compromise flashings and loose tiles. Many older properties contend with outdated roofing that wasn't designed for the area's temperature swings, and some homes in more remote areas face challenges with proper ventilation and moisture management.
